It's all good, it ain't no thing. Easy-going Abz has left the Big Brother House ias the runner-up in second place.

His critics remarked that Abz was a little too quiet throughout his time and it's fair to say he spent a lot of it deep in contemplation while other more vocal HMs got on with moaning, gossiping and arguing. Which isn't necessarily a bad thing.

When not wowing housemates with his thoughts on quantum physics and the unconscious mind, Abz spent a lot of time with Dustin - the pair eventually dubbed "Dabz". They got into deep topics, came up with a tune or two and he also shared his contemplation schedule with our former Screech.

Abz also became quite close to Courtney, though the pair did seem to nominate one another quite a bit. Their conversations were often touching and they also shared a hobby of saving bugs from drowning in the pool. The lovely pair.

Early on, Sophie told Abz to come out of his shell but he was the proverbial still water running deep. He opened up whenever Big Brother ordered him to in a task, though he was always game when it came to disco-dancing or performing his band's hits for food.

He showed himself to be a sensitive soul, and a generous one at that, giving thoughtful gifts to his housemates. Truly, he is full of the milk of human kindness.

A calming, upbeat, positive presence in an otherwise wild and crazy House, thanks for the pleasant vibes Abz. 'If you're getting down' to Borehamwood any time soon, we'd love to see your face!
